WebWhat is a tubal ligation (sterilisation)? Tubal ligation is a minor surgical procedure which blocks the two fallopian tubes with small clips. Fallopian tubes are the pathway for the egg to enter the uterus. This method of contraception is sometimes also called sterilisation or “having your tubes tied”. Illustration of tubal ligation. Essentially, a tubal ligation reversal surgery is a reconnection of the cut or blocked areas of the fallopian tubes. With a successful outcome, a woman can achieve pregnancy naturally. WebSep 16, 2024 · If a woman covered by Medicaid wants her tubes tied, she must complete the “Consent to Sterilization” section of Medicaid’s Title XIX form at least 30 days, and no more than 180 days, before ...
